I think aqad means on an outdrive (aquadrive) and TAMD means shaft.

Found this on another thread

AQAD = Aquamatic after cooled marine diesel, ‘Aquamatic’ being old VP tong for an outdrive
AQD = Aquamatic marine diesel, ie non after cooled lower output
TAMD = Turbo after cooled marine diesel, same as an AQAD only inboard
TMD = see AQD
MD = non turbo, marine diesel
AD = later version of AQAD
KAD = like an AQAD only supercharged
KAMD = see TAMD, but add on the supercharger
